A London-based educational recruitment agency seeks an experienced SENDCo for a primary school in Tower Hamlets. In this full-time, fixed-term role, you will lead and develop SEND provision, oversee EHCP applications, and support teachers to ensure inclusive practices.

Ideal candidates will have:

  • QTS
  • NASENCo qualifications
  • Strong knowledge of SEND guidelines

This position offers a chance to make a meaningful impact within a supportive school community and contribute to student success.
